What is the total fee for MDI Gurgaon's PGDM programme?

Claude's answer·2 min read·501 words·✓ verified Mar 2026

MDI Gurgaon's PGDM programme costs approximately ₹26 lakh all-in for the 2025-27 batch, covering tuition, hostel, and mess. Plan for ₹27-28 lakh if you're targeting the 2026-28 cohort, as annual fee revisions are standard practice.

What the Fee Covers

The ₹26 lakh bundles tuition (roughly ₹21-22 lakh) with hostel and mess charges of ₹4-5 lakh across two years. This is worth noting because many B-schools advertise only the tuition line, making comparisons misleading.

MDI's bundled structure covers study materials, Wi-Fi, gym access, and most club events. Budget separately for international immersion programmes and elective certifications, which carry additional charges not included in the headline figure.

Cost ComponentApproximate Amount
Tuition (2 years)₹21-22 lakh
Hostel + Mess (2 years)₹4-5 lakh
Total (2025-27 batch)₹26 lakh
Projected (2026-28 batch)₹27-28 lakh

How MDI Compares to Peer Institutions

At ₹26 lakh, MDI sits below most IIM programmes.

IIM Calcutta's PGP runs close to ₹29 lakh, and IIM Bangalore approaches ₹24-25 lakh for tuition alone, with accommodation pushing the total higher.

FMS Delhi costs a fraction of this, but seats are scarce and competition is brutal. For the Delhi-NCR location, campus quality, and recruiter access MDI offers, the fee is competitive rather than premium.

Financing the Fee

MDI has established tie-ups with SBI, HDFC Bank, and Axis Bank, among others. Banks typically sanction up to ₹30 lakh without collateral for admitted students at top B-schools, and MDI's placement track record makes approvals routine. Interest rates for strong profiles range from 9-10.5%, with repayment tenures extending to 10-15 years. Most students finance the full amount through loans and begin repayment post-placement, keeping the immediate financial burden manageable.

Return on Investment

The ₹26 lakh investment looks reasonable against MDI's Class of 2024 placement numbers. The average CTC stood at ₹28.5 LPA, and the highest domestic offer reached ₹58 LPA. At the median, payback takes roughly 2.5-3 years, faster if you land consulting or banking roles.

Key recruiters who return to campus consistently include

  • McKinsey, BCG, and Deloitte for consulting mandates
  • Goldman Sachs and Morgan Stanley for finance roles
  • HUL, Asian Paints, and Amazon for marketing and general management

MDI's Delhi-NCR location is a real accelerant here. Proximity to corporate headquarters means stronger lateral networks, faster visibility to senior leadership, and second-year internships that often convert at above-average packages.
